Year 7 have been developing a radio drama project over the past few weeks. After learning about foley artistry – where you record your own sound effects live, then add them onto a script in post-production, they got to work putting together their own mini radio plays.

They were given one page of script from BBC Radio 4’s adaptation of Neil Gaiman’s book – How the Marquis Got His Coat Back and then asked to write two more pages, including sound effects. Once they had completed the script, they had to create their sounds and put it all together. Some sound effects were performed live and others recorded in advance. Their endings are all very different, but the results are fantastic. It really does sound like you’ve tuned into BBC Radio 4! They are very professionally done. Well done, boys. Great work!
